We Are The Authentic APC In Kwara - Factional Deputy Chairman

Date: 2018-06-13

Alhaji Abdullahi Samari, Deputy Chairman of Chief Bashir Bolarinwa-led faction of the All Progressives Congress, in Kwara has declared the faction as the authentic APC in the state.

Samari who made the claim while speaking to newsmen on Wednesday in Ilorin said the faction was made up of members advocating the return of President Muhammadu Buhari in 2019.

He claimed that Mallam Bolaji Abdullahi, the national Publicity Secretary of the party had no moral right to declare his faction as not recognised in the party.

It will be recalled that the party national leadership had recognised the Alhaji Isola Balogun-Fulani led faction as the authentic APC in Kwara after the appeal committee panel sat on the recently held party congresses in the state.

According to Samari, the congress held by his faction at the Arca Centre in Ilorin was attended by President Muhammadu Buhari's loyalists in Kwara.

He said: "It is an amalgamation of all Buhari/Osinbajo 2019 re-election support groups in Kwara State against the insinuation of Abdullahi that we are fame seekers." Samari appealed to members and leaders of the party, particularly executives in Abuja to be wary of members of the New Peoples Democratic Party (nPDP) in APC "as they are out to destroy the party".

He said: "Committed and loyal leaders of our party should be wary of their likes still hob-nobbling at the national level and to always objectively weigh their counsel."

"Members of the nPDP led by Alhaji Kawu Baraje and the Senate President, Bukola Saraki will eventually leave APC, but not until they destroyed it.

"It is no longer news that Bolaji and his masters are now hell bent at de-marketing our great party before commencing their journey to an unknown destination. "Since it is clear that they are only preparing ground for their eventual exit from the party, we passionately request them to do so on time.

"Let it not be like the Yoruba proverb that say when a white man is living, he will defecate on the seat." Samari described the claim of marginalization by nPDP members as frivolous, saying that they were the one that benefitted more than any group from President Buhari's government.

He commended the President for declaring June 12 as Democracy Day in Nigeria.

He said: "We are indeed very proud of our forward looking leader, President Buhari who has shown again that he is committed to the promotion of democratic values."

Samari appealed to the people of Kwara to give Buhari a second term to pave the way for true democracy and for the benefit of the state.
